Alexandria, Virginia, steeped in American history, offers a unique living experience in its Baggett Tract neighborhood. This area, known for its historical significance, is part of the City of Alexandria. The Baggett Tract, in particular, is celebrated for its historical homes and community resources. Residents enjoy easy access to historic landmarks such as the Carlyle House and Gadsby's Tavern, as well as modern conveniences like the Alexandria Library and the vibrant King Street corridor. The neighborhood's proximity to the Potomac River and numerous parks, including Founders Park and Windmill Hill Park, adds to its appeal.

Welcome to the charming townhouse at 1603 Princess St in Old Town Alexandria. Located within the Parker-Gray Historic District, this all-brick townhouse, built in 1945, resonates with the area's rich history. The neighborhood's walkability, with a score of 91, and close proximity to two Metro stations, adds to its desirability. An article in the Alexandria Times emphasizes the importance of preserving the character of historic districts like Parker-Gray. This commitment to maintaining Alexandria's historical heritage enhances the city's allure as a place to live. Falls Church, Virginia, offers residents a unique blend of suburban comfort and urban accessibility, especially evident in the Byron Condominium community. Situated in the heart of Falls Church, the Byron Condominium stands out for its contemporary design, upscale amenities, and strategic location. Residents enjoy easy access to a variety of dining and shopping options, local parks like Cherry Hill Park, and cultural attractions including the State Theatre. This area is well-connected through major transportation routes such as I-66 and Route 29, as well as the nearby West Falls Church and East Falls Church Metro stations, offering convenient access to the greater Washington D.C. area.
